"Absolutely disgusted"

About: Poole General Hospital / Accident and emergency

After an jogging accident down the beach slipping and falling with discolated shoulder severe cuts to head which happend at 1pm the shoulder wasn't taken care of until about 5 hours later which resulted in it being more difficult to put back in,after 2 lots of morphine and gas and air the administered ketamine and sedation to put the shoulder back, the severe cuts wasn't taken care of in A&E where it should of been done and stitched the next day around 3.30pm but the Dr said oh it's ok it won't need stitching then a nurse had a look and it was very deep needed washing out and 4 stitches. Also while waiting for my partner to have her shoulder put back in we got told to wait in a relatives room where there was a family who just had a relation died it was not fair or very respectful for them to have us put in that room where they want to grieve and cry without strangers in there. I am absolutely disgusted with the service and time frames in which Poole hospital deal with emergencies or even general wellbeing of patients. Things are not being told to doctors dealing with patients so every time a patient sees a new nurse or Dr you have to repeat the same thing over and over. You ask for a dressing change it takes over an hour or two complete joke.we are not happy my partner who had this fall is 65
